The conversion of the Berlin Zeughaus (armoury) to a museum and Hall of Fame was carried out at the request of Kaiser Wilhelm I. Architectural works began in 1877 and were completed by January 1881. By far the most significant alterations were made in the upper north wing, where vast sections of the original structure were removed for the creation of a large domed hall, as shown here following major demolition works in August 1878.
